Best Local Businesses in Menomonee Falls, Wisconsin

Add Your Business
  1. US
  2. WI
  3. Menomonee Falls

Latest On TrustAnalytica

Companies
Reviews
Top List
Barbara
3 months ago
Horrible company! They like to illegally dumb their trash in our neighborhoods in broad daylight so they have definitely done it before.